Question #42 Topic 1

A company has a compute workload that is steady, predictable, and uninterruptible. Which Amazon EC2 instance purchasing options meet these requirements MOST cost-effectively? (Choose two.)

  • A . On-Demand Instances
  • B . Reserved Instances
  • C . Spot Instances
  • D . Saving Plans
  • E . Dedicated Hosts
Suggested Answer: BD
NOTE: For a compute workload that is steady, predictable, and uninterruptible, Reserved Instances and Saving Plans are the most cost-effective options. Reserved Instances provide you with a significant discount (up to 75%) compared to On-Demand instance pricing, and you can choose to commit to usage of specific instances to further reduce your cost. Similarly, Saving Plans offer lower prices on Amazon EC2 instance usage, no matter the instance family, size, OS, tenancy or AWS region.
Question #43 Topic 1

A user wants to review all Amazon S3 buckets with ACLs and S3 bucket policies in the S3 console. Which AWS service or resource will meet this requirement?

  • A . S3 Multi-Region ccess Points
  • B . S3 Storage Lens
  • C . AWS IAM Identity enter (AWS Single Sign-On)
  • D . Access Analyzer for S3
Suggested Answer: D
NOTE: Access Analyzer for S3 is an AWS service that makes it simple for security and access administrators to check and manage, at scale, resource policies for compliance and security. With Access Analyzer for S3, you can review all Amazon S3 buckets with ACLs and S3 bucket policies.

Question #45 Topic 1

A company has an uninterruptible application that runs on Amazon EC2 instances. The application constantly processes a backlog of files in an Amazon Simple Queue Service (Amazon SQS) queue. This usage is expected to continue to grow for years. What is the MOST cost-effective EC2 instance purchasing model to meet these requirements?

  • A . Spot Instances
  • B . On-Demand Instances
  • C . Savings Plans
  • D . edicated Hosts
Suggested Answer: C
NOTE: The Savings Plans are a flexible pricing model that offer significant savings compared to On-Demand pricing. Given the context indicates a continuous growth and high usage of Amazon EC2 instances, Savings Plans would be the most cost-effective choice among all the given options.
